Преглед изворни кода

mybatis-plus相关依赖优化

rengb пре 3 година
родитељ
комит
04afc936d8
4 измењених фајлова са 6 додато и 16 уклоњено
  1. 2 2
      common/pom.xml
  2. 1 6
      dblayer-mbg/pom.xml
  3. 0 4
      gateway-service/pom.xml
  4. 3 4
      pom.xml

+ 2 - 2
common/pom.xml

@@ -91,8 +91,8 @@
         <dependency>
             <groupId>com.baomidou</groupId>
             <artifactId>mybatis-plus-extension</artifactId>
-            <version>3.4.3</version>
-            <scope>compile</scope>
+            <version>${mybatis-plus.version}</version>
+            <optional>true</optional>
         </dependency>
     </dependencies>
 

+ 1 - 6
dblayer-mbg/pom.xml

@@ -17,12 +17,6 @@
         <dependency>
             <groupId>com.lantone</groupId>
             <artifactId>common</artifactId>
-            <exclusions>
-                <exclusion>
-                    <groupId>com.baomidou</groupId>
-                    <artifactId>mybatis-plus-extension</artifactId>
-                </exclusion>
-            </exclusions>
         </dependency>
         <dependency>
             <groupId>com.alibaba</groupId>
@@ -43,6 +37,7 @@
         <dependency>
             <groupId>org.freemarker</groupId>
             <artifactId>freemarker</artifactId>
+            <optional>true</optional>
         </dependency>
     </dependencies>
 

+ 0 - 4
gateway-service/pom.xml

@@ -36,10 +36,6 @@
             <groupId>com.github.xiaoymin</groupId>
             <artifactId>knife4j-spring-boot-starter</artifactId>
         </dependency>
-        <dependency>
-            <groupId>org.projectlombok</groupId>
-            <artifactId>lombok</artifactId>
-        </dependency>
         <dependency>
             <groupId>org.springframework.security</groupId>
             <artifactId>spring-security-config</artifactId>

+ 3 - 4
pom.xml

@@ -33,11 +33,10 @@
         <java.version>1.8</java.version>
         <spring-cloud.version>Hoxton.SR5</spring-cloud.version>
         <spring-boot-admin-starter-server.version>2.2.3</spring-boot-admin-starter-server.version>
-        <mybatis-plus-boot-starter.version>3.2.0</mybatis-plus-boot-starter.version>
+        <mybatis-plus.version>3.2.0</mybatis-plus.version>
         <mysql-connector-java.version>8.0.18</mysql-connector-java.version>
         <ojdbc6.version>11.2.0.3</ojdbc6.version>
         <druid-spring-boot-starter.version>1.1.16</druid-spring-boot-starter.version>
-        <mybatis-plus-generator.version>3.2.0</mybatis-plus-generator.version>
         <velocity-engine-core.version>2.1</velocity-engine-core.version>
         <freemarker.version>2.3.29</freemarker.version>
         <beetl.version>3.0.13.RELEASE</beetl.version>
@@ -91,7 +90,7 @@
             <dependency>
                 <groupId>com.baomidou</groupId>
                 <artifactId>mybatis-plus-boot-starter</artifactId>
-                <version>${mybatis-plus-boot-starter.version}</version>
+                <version>${mybatis-plus.version}</version>
             </dependency>
 
             <!-- mysql数据库依赖 依赖 -->
@@ -119,7 +118,7 @@
             <dependency>
                 <groupId>com.baomidou</groupId>
                 <artifactId>mybatis-plus-generator</artifactId>
-                <version>${mybatis-plus-generator.version}</version>
+                <version>${mybatis-plus.version}</version>
                 <scope>test</scope>
             </dependency>
             <dependency>